    Obviously the outcome of this match could've gone completely differently. We were lucky, clinical, and executed our game plan well.

    I guess Arteta thought to himself "if ever there's a time for us to win at home by ceding possession, playing in a shell and hoping for a few breaks, then playing the champions in our empty stadium is that time!"

    But one not so little turning point came in stoppage time. Shaquiri put the equalizer in the net, but it was quickly whistled out, apparently because of a foul on Tierney. Origi or Winaldum or whoever got his arm onto the side of Kieran's face. Who then made a meal of that foul and the ref bought it.

    It was the kind of embellished, earned-foul that we'd complain about an opponent doing, and it seemed to me a fairly innocuous knock, but had Tierney not thought to do that, we'd certainly have given them back 1 point at least.

    Fine margins. But I'll certainly take the 3 pts... against Liverpool! And it keeps our UEFA hopes alive, and I'm of the school that we need to be in that tournament for different reasons.
